serial: 8250_dw: only setup the port from one place This adds a flag "skip_autocfg" that the platforms that do not have the ADDITIONAL_FEATURES implemented can use to skip the port setup. It's then enough to call dw8250_setup_port just from dw8250_probe based on that flag.
